How do I customize my Start button?

Head to Settings > Personalization > Start. On the right, scroll all the way to the bottom and click the “Choose which folders appear on Start” link. Choose whatever folders you want to appear on the Start menu. And here's a side-by-side look at how those new folders look as icons and in the expanded view.

Can we change the position of start button?

by default, there is not a way to change the start button position, just the taskbar itself.

How do I change the Start menu power button action in Windows 10?

To change the default behavior, right-click on the taskbar and, from the right-click menu, select Properties. The "Taskbar and Start Menu Properties" window opens. Click on the Start Menu tab. Click on the "Power button action" drop-down list and select the action you want to set as default.

How do I clean my Start menu in Windows 10?

The best thing to do is uninstall these apps. In the search box, start typing "add" and the Add or remove programs option will come up. Click it. Scroll on down to the offending app, click it, and then click Uninstall.

Why is my Start menu so small?

To change the height of the Start menu, position your cursor on the top edge of the Start menu, then hold down the left mouse button and drag your mouse up or down. ... You can also change the width of the Start menu the same way: Grab its right edge with the resize cursor and drag your mouse to make it larger or smaller.

How do I switch back to Windows on my desktop?

How to Get to the Desktop in Windows 10

  1. Click the icon in the lower right corner of the screen. It looks like a tiny rectangle that's next to your notification icon. ...
  2. Right click on the taskbar. ...
  3. Select Show the desktop from the menu.
  4. Hit Windows Key + D to toggle back and forth from the desktop.

How do I change my Windows 10 desktop to normal?

How Do I Get My Desktop Back to Normal on Windows 10

  1. Press Windows key and I key together to open Settings.
  2. In the pop-up window, choose System to continue.
  3. On the left panel, choose Tablet Mode.
  4. Check Don't ask me and don't switch.

How do I unlock the Start menu in Windows 10?

Unlocking From The Start Menu

  1. Right-click your Start Menu.
  2. Click "Lock the Taskbar" from the menu that appears.
  3. Right-click the Start Menu again and make sure the check mark has been removed from the left of the "Lock the Taskbar" option.
